XC2S200-6FGG1278C Xilinx Spartan-II FPGA: Complete Technical Overview

Product Details

The XC2S200-6FGG1278C is a high-performance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) from the renowned Xilinx Spartan-II family. Designed to bridge the gap between expensive ASICs and traditional CPLDs, this device offers 200,000 system gates and superior programmable logic capabilities. Whether you are developing complex telecommunications infrastructure or industrial automation systems, the XC2S200-6FGG1278C provides the flexibility and speed required for modern digital designs.

Key Features of the XC2S200-6FGG1278C FPGA

The XC2S200-6FGG1278C stands out due to its balanced architecture and robust feature set. Furthermore, it utilizes advanced 0.18-micron CMOS technology to deliver high density and low power consumption.

Advanced Memory Architecture

The device features the SelectRAM+™ hierarchy, which provides both distributed and block RAM. Specifically, the block RAM consists of two columns of dedicated 4,096-bit synchronous RAM blocks. This allows for efficient data buffering and FIFO implementations directly on-chip.

Superior Clock Management

Timing is critical in high-speed circuits. Consequently, the XC2S200-6FGG1278C includes four dedicated Delay-Locked Loops (DLLs). These DLLs eliminate clock distribution delay and provide precise phase shifting, supporting system clock frequencies up to 200 MHz and beyond.

Versatile I/O Standards

Modern systems often require multiple voltage domains. Therefore, this FPGA supports 16 different I/O standards, including LVTTL, LVCMOS, PCI, and various differential signaling modes like LVDS. This flexibility eliminates the need for external level shifters in many designs.

Applications of the XC2S200-6FGG1278C Series

Due to its high gate count and extensive I/O capabilities, the XC2S200-6FGG1278C is suitable for a wide variety of industries. For example, it is frequently used in:

  • Communications: Protocol bridging, ATM cell processing, and channel coding.

  • Industrial Automation: High-speed motor control and PLC logic replacement.

  • Consumer Electronics: Video processing and high-resolution display drivers.

  • Data Processing: Real-time signal filtering and hardware-accelerated algorithms.

Development Support

The XC2S200-6FGG1278C is fully supported by the Xilinx ISE® Design Suite. This comprehensive toolset includes features for:

  1. HDL synthesis (VHDL and Verilog support).

  2. Advanced place-and-route optimization.

  3. Static timing analysis to ensure design reliability.

  4. In-system debugging via JTAG boundary-scan logic.
